Tolls at bridges across the Bay Area and fares at BART are set to increase starting Jan. 1 as agencies look for ways to pay off debts and continue with operations.

Chance is a little sprite at 7 pounds. He's an adorable and sweet Chihuahua mix puppy who loves to cuddle with his foster family. He's friendly and cute and gets along with other similar size dogs.
